Operating thermal equipment in a tropical, humid marine environment presents distinct thermodynamic hurdles. Ambient relative humidity often exceeding 80% demands drying systems with superior insulation, specialized dew point compensation, and highly efficient heat exchangers. Standard configuration dryers suffer heavy thermal losses under these conditions. Jiangsu Zongheng's MQG Airflow Dryers are specifically re-engineered with adaptive high-velocity air intakes to guarantee consistent dry air mass flow, even during the peak wet seasons in Trinidad.

Understanding mass and heat transfer inside the MQG drying column to achieve rapid moisture reduction.
Our airflow dryers feature alternating tube diameters. This design generates sudden velocity changes in the pneumatic drying stream. The constant deceleration and acceleration disrupt the boundary layer surrounding the wet particles, resulting in convective heat transfer coefficients that are up to 300% higher than traditional straight-pipe dryers.
Flash drying occurs in a window of 0.5 to 2 seconds. Surface moisture flashes off almost instantly. The core temperature of heat-sensitive materials (such as organic food starches or biological substances) remains low, preserving chemical structures, color, nutritional content, and functional properties.
To support Trinidad's environmental goals, the MQG system can be configured to recirculate up to 50% of the exhaust gas. By pairing the dryer with our multi-effect falling film evaporators, waste steam can be captured and recycled, lowering fuel consumption by 20% to 35% compared to single-pass designs.
| Dryer Model / Series | Air Velocity (m/s) | Evaporation Rate (kg H2O/h) | Heat Source Compatibility | Typical Applications in Trinidad |
|---|---|---|---|---|
| MQG-I (Standard) | 18 - 25 | 150 - 800 | Steam, Natural Gas, Diesel | Cassava Starch, Arrowroot Processing |
| MQG-II (High Capacity) | 22 - 30 | 800 - 2,500 | Natural Gas Direct Fire, Waste Heat Steam | Brewery Spent Grain (DDGS), Feed Additives |
| MQG-III (Industrial Duty) | 25 - 35 | 2,500 - 6,000+ | Flue Gas, High Pressure Boiler Steam | Chemical Minerals, Fertilizer Materials, Sludge |

Combining mechanical separation, evaporation, and flash thermal drying for zero-liquid discharge (ZLD) and high product recovery.
Raw solid-liquid slurries (like cassava pulp or chemical sludge) are processed through our Single Screw Press. Mechanical dewatering reduces water content down to 50%-60%, cutting down the energy required for thermal drying phases.
Liquids containing dissolved solids are processed in our MVR Evaporation Plant or Multi-Effect Falling Film Evaporation systems, concentrating the solution into a thick syrup. This steam-efficient phase is key for wastewater volume reduction.
The dewatered cake is combined with concentrated syrup and fed into the MQG Airflow Dryer. High-velocity hot air dries the material in milliseconds, yielding a dry, free-flowing powder containing less than 12% moisture.

Our MQG series is designed to handle feed materials with initial moisture contents ranging from 35% to 60% (following mechanical dewatering) and reduce them to final moisture levels of 8% to 12% in a single, continuous pass. This rapid moisture flash is ideal for starch, feed proteins, and fine mineral processing.
Yes. The thermal air furnaces can be custom-fitted with direct-fired natural gas burners or indirect steam gas boilers. Given Trinidad's extensive natural gas infrastructure, utilizing gas-fired heat exchangers provides the lowest operating cost per metric ton of evaporated water.
Yes, Jiangsu Zongheng holds the official ASME "U" Stamp authorization. All pressure vessels, bundle tubes, and heat exchangers are constructed, inspected, and stamped in compliance with ASME Section VIII Division 1 code requirements.
To resist salt-air corrosion typical of industrial sites near Trinidad's coasts (like Point Lisas), we construct contact parts from high-grade stainless steel (SUS304 or SUS316L) and utilize specialized marine-grade protective paint systems on exterior structural frames.
